Meat Preparation
1. Prepare the Marinade
In a blender, combine the garlic cloves, dried red chili peppers, cumin, oregano, salt, black pepper, olive oil, and water. Blend until smooth to create a marinade.
2. Marinate the Pork
Cut the pork shoulder into chunks and place them in a large bowl. Pour the marinade over the pork, ensuring it is well coated. Cover and let it marinate in the refrigerator for at least 2 hours, preferably overnight.
3. Cook the Pork
Preheat your oven to 300°F (150°C). Place the marinated pork in a baking dish and cover with foil. Bake for 3 hours or until the pork is tender and can be easily shredded with a fork.
Burrito Assembly
5. Prepare the Tortillas
Warm the flour tortillas in a dry skillet over medium heat for about 30 seconds on each side, just until pliable.
6. Assemble the Burritos
On each tortilla, place a generous portion of shredded carne adovada, followed by a handful of shredded cheddar cheese, lettuce, diced tomatoes, a dollop of sour cream, and slices of avocado.
7. Fold the Burritos
Fold the sides of the tortilla over the filling, and then roll it up tightly from the bottom to the top to enclose the filling.
8. Serve
Serve the burritos warm with additional sour cream or salsa on the side.
